Is there symbolic support for SSE regs? The amd64 ABI specifies that SSE
must be present on those architectures, and i have not been successful in
convincing libc to NOT use SSE enabled versions of it's functions.

Looking for information on either KLEE support for this, or how to force an
application in QEMU into using non-SSE libc functions.

Aside: Given how things are evolving, it would appear that SSE will simply
grow more prevalent and harder to avoid...
